| Background |
Saudi Arabian Oil CompanySaudi Arabian Oil Company (AramcoAramco ) plans to develop the Karan Gas Field as part of an investment program to meet the kingdom's soaring demand for gas, at Karan offshore, Saudi Arabia. The project is divided into an offshore and onshore package and comprises the construction of three main facilities: gas processing facility at the Manifa facility, platforms and power generation units and a subsea pipeline. The offshore Karan field is about 100 km north of the giant onshore Ghawar oilfield and estimated to contain 9 trillion cu.ft/d of gas. Upon completion, the Karan Field is expected to produce 1.8 billion cu.ft./d of gas. Foster WheelerFoster Wheeler is the FEED study consultant and PMC for the onshore packages. Petrocon ArabiaPetrocon Arabia is the FEED study consultant and the PMC for the offshore packages. |
| Latest Events |
In July 2011, first production started, marking the completion of the project. |
| Previous Events |
In Q3 2009, work on the project started. In March 2009, the EPC contracts for the four packages were awarded. The onshore package was awarded to Hyundai Engineering and ConstructionHyundai Engineering and Construction Company. The sulphur recovery unit was awarded to GS Engineering and Construction CompanyGS Engineering and Construction Company . The Platforms and Pipeline package was awarded to J Ray Mc DermottJ Ray Mc Dermott . In July 2008, AramcoAramco announced that it will increase the output capacity of Karan to 1.8 billion cu.ft/d from 1.5 billion cu.ft/d. In February 2008, Saudi AramcoAramco announced that the gas will be processed at a facility in Manifia not Khursaniyah as originally planned. In 2007, the combined FEED study and PMC contract for the offshore package was awarded to Petrocon ArabiaPetrocon Arabia . In May 2007, the combined FEED study and PMC contract for the onshore package was awarded to Foster WheelerFoster Wheeler . In April 2007, bids for the combined FEED study and PMC contract for the onshore package were submitted. |
